Output e31a7e70bc8a9bc23589b58d9e73d95747d6824262b4f3b05df7440b668a98fe:3

value
62500000
script pubkey
OP_0 OP_PUSHBYTES_20 538249822821333c24accc2fa05c0418dc10c8ec
address
bc1q2wpynq3gyyencf9vesh6qhqyrrwppj8vu2rnzw
transaction
e31a7e70bc8a9bc23589b58d9e73d95747d6824262b4f3b05df7440b668a98fe
spent
true